Luis and BenB are right about the range of orange usage. There are other ways to determine if it is in use.


1. Switch the browser to list view with option+⌘2. The media in use will have a triangle mark on the left.


2. Click on the triangle mark and it will say “In use”. If it is not used, it will not be marked. Please try switching the browser display method depending on your usage.
